This Pursuit 3800 Express is a versatile and well maintained boat known for its combination of fishing prowess
and comfortable cruising capabilities. The modified V hull with a solid fiberglass bottom provides a stable and smooth
ride even in rough waters. The spacious cockpit is well-equipped for the serious angler, including coaming bolsters, a
transom door, and a large fish box. This Pursuit is also equipped with 10x rocket launchers on the tower, a 50-gallon
aquarium live well, a bait prep station, a bait freezer with a removable bait box, a removable fish box, and custom tackle
drawers. Equipped with a Simrad Electronics package, radar and autopilot. The interior cabin is designed for comfort
with plush seating, a well-appointed galley, and sleeping accommodations that make it suitable for extended trips. It is in
impeccable condition. The galley contains a brand-new microwave, two burners, refrigeration, and a freezer. The cabin
includes a queen-sized berth and a combination twin berth/settee. The head consists of a stand-up separate shower
stall. This Pursuit also has an impressive glassed-in rod locker with ambient lighting. Thoughtfully designed to balance
both fishing and leisure activities, ensuring a comfortable experience whether you're out for a day trip or a more extended
voyage.

Overview
The Pursuit 3800 Express stands as the flagship model in the Pursuit fleet, designed for serious offshore fishing enthusiasts who demand both performance and comfort. This 38-foot express boat combines rugged construction with refined design elements, making it suitable for tournament fishing as well as leisurely cruising. The 3800 Express reflects years of development and refinement, delivering a premier boating experience in its class.
Exterior Design and Bridge
The 3800 Express features a robust and thoughtfully designed exterior optimized for offshore conditions. The bow is equipped with a molded anchor roller and hawse pipe integrated into the bow pulpit, complemented by a large anchor locker that includes both fresh and saltwater washdowns. The foredeck is finished with a non-skid surface and illuminated by three low-profile deck hatches that enhance natural light below deck. A wraparound windshield contributes to the sleek express styling. The cockpit is purpose-built for serious anglers, featuring a spacious live well with a viewing port and tackle storage beneath, a mate’s seat with additional tackle drawers, floor storage compartments, and a large fish box integrated into the cockpit sole. The transom includes a tuna gate designed to accommodate oversized catches, alongside a flip-up aft bench seat suitable for casual cruising. The bridge deck offers comfortable seating for guests and crew, with the helm station to starboard equipped with digital instrumentation and precise electronic controls for efficient navigation. A wet bar with an isotherm refrigerator is located just aft of the helm, and the entire bridge deck raises hydraulically to reveal a spacious engine compartment, allowing easy access for maintenance.
Interior Living Spaces
Below deck, the salon is appointed with teak veneered walls and a teak and holly sole, providing both elegance and practicality with ample storage beneath the flooring. The settee to starboard converts into a double berth, enhancing sleeping accommodations. The adjacent galley is fully equipped with a sink and sprayer, stove, and refrigerator/freezer, facilitating comfortable extended stays aboard. To port, a tournament rod locker is incorporated alongside a leather couch that converts into an over-and-under double bunk arrangement. Forward of the galley, the full-sized head includes a shower, and the owner’s stateroom is located at the bow, featuring a privacy curtain for added seclusion.
Power and Performance
Powered by twin Volvo 74P diesel engines, the 3800 Express delivers a commanding performance on the water. During testing, the boat achieved a top speed of 37.7 miles per hour at 2650 RPM. The optimal cruising speed was determined to be 27.5 miles per hour at 2000 RPM, which provides an impressive range of approximately 376 miles based on the 450-gallon fuel capacity. The vessel demonstrates quick planing capabilities, reaching plane in just 15.3 seconds. Its wide beam of 14 feet 2 inches and overall length of 40 feet 11 inches contribute to a stable and comfortable ride, even in challenging offshore conditions.

The Biggest Pros and Cons
The 2002 Pursuit 3800 Express is a well-regarded sportfishing and cruising boat that offers a blend of performance, comfort, and quality craftsmanship. Here are some of the pros and cons to consider:
Pros
Solid Construction: Built with high-quality materials and attention to detail, the Pursuit 3800 Express is known for its durability and seaworthiness.
Spacious Interior: The cabin layout is roomy for a 38-foot boat, featuring comfortable sleeping accommodations, a full galley, and a well-appointed head, making it suitable for extended trips.
Performance: Powered typically by twin diesel or gas engines, it offers reliable and efficient performance with good handling in various sea conditions.
Fishing Amenities: Designed with sportfishing in mind, it includes features like a large cockpit, rod holders, and live wells.
Comfort and Amenities: The boat provides a good balance between fishing capabilities and cruising comfort, with air conditioning, ample storage, and quality finishes.
Cons
Aging Systems: Being a 2002 model, some onboard systems such as electronics, plumbing, and wiring may require updating or maintenance.
Fuel Consumption: Depending on the engine setup, fuel efficiency might be moderate, which is typical for boats in this class.
Limited Headroom: While spacious, the cabin headroom may feel a bit restricted for taller individuals.
Maintenance Costs: As with many older express cruisers, upkeep and maintenance can be costly, especially if the boat has seen heavy use.
